Native here.

Don't go to Myengdong. It's all Chinese people now.

Hongdae or garosugil for the urban feel. Around Gangnam subway station for the crowded feel.

Go to palaces in downtown if you are a history buff, but otherwise it gets really boring really quick. Go to Insadong or Bukchon for the "Asian feel".

What do you mean you are "going to the DMZ". Do you mean the Joint Security Area? Not sure if it's worth your time. Unique experience, but not that much to see.

Food is great. Try traditional food if you are feeling adventurous. But Korean style pizza and chicken can be delivered virtually anywhere really quickly.

Pro tip: Get T-money. Cheaper transportation and free transfers between buses and subways. Try not to get a cab. Might get ripped off. Sadly, Uber is illegal in Korea, so stick to public transportation.

Most state-run museums, including the war memorial museum and the national history museum, are free, so they're worth checking out.

Also, if there's a clear day, go hiking on mount namsan. Right by myeongdong, it's beautifully preserved and has the best views in the city. N Seoul Tower is there too, but it's a bit too touristy for my taste.
